Partial answer: when you describe with dots replacing spaces and ¶ signs indicating ends of paragraphs, you're describing what you see when you activate "Show … formatting symbols". Don't know about 2013, but in 2010 the keyboard shortcut is Ctrl + 8. It's a toggle, so each time you press Ctrl + 8 the symbols either appear or disappear. I suspect that "top of form", similarly, is just Word displaying some information about the document you're not used to seeing.
